21: #define ISI68K
22:
23: /* The following three symbols give information on
24: the size of various data types. */
25:
26: #define SHORTBITS 16 /* Number of bits in a short */
27:
28: #define INTBITS 32 /* Number of bits in an int */
29:
30: #define LONGBITS 32 /* Number of bits in a long */
31:
32: /* 68000 has lowest-numbered byte as most significant */
33:
34: #define BIG_ENDIAN
35:
36: /* Define how to take a char and sign-extend into an int.
37: On machines where char is signed, this is a no-op. */
38:
39: #define SIGN_EXTEND_CHAR(c) (c)
40:
41: /* Say this machine is a 68000 */
42:
43: #define m68000
44:
45: /* Use type int rather than a union, to represent Lisp_Object */
46:
47: #define NO_UNION_TYPE
48:
49: /* XINT must explicitly sign-extend */
50:
51: #define EXPLICIT_SIGN_EXTEND
52:
53: /* Data type of load average, as read out of kmem. */
54:
55: #ifdef BSD4_3
56: #define LOAD_AVE_TYPE long
57: #else
58: #define LOAD_AVE_TYPE double
59: #endif BSD4_3
60:
61: /* Convert that into an integer that is 100 for a load average of 1.0 */
62:
63: #ifdef BSD4_3
64: #define LOAD_AVE_CVT(x) (int) (((double) (x)) * 100.0 / FSCALE)
65: #else
66: #define LOAD_AVE_CVT(x) ((int) ((x) * 100.0))
67: #endif
68:
69: /* Mask for address bits within a memory segment */
70:
71: #define SEGMENT_MASK 0x1ffff
72:
73: /* use the -20 switch to get the 68020 code */
74: /* #define C_SWITCH_MACHINE -20 */
75:
76: /* Use the version of the library for the 68020
77: because the standard library requires some special hacks in crt0
78: which the GNU crt0 does not have. */
79:
80: #define LIB_STANDARD -lmc
81:
82: /* macros to make unexec work right */
83:
84: #define A_TEXT_OFFSET(HDR) sizeof(HDR)
85: #define A_TEXT_SEEK(HDR) sizeof(HDR)
86:
87: /* A few changes for the newer systems. */
88:
89: #ifdef BSD4_3
90: #define HAVE_ALLOCA
91: /* The following line affects crt0.c. */
92: #undef m68k
93:
94: #undef LIB_STANDARD
95: #define LIB_STANDARD -lmc -lc
96: #define C_DEBUG_SWITCH -20 -O -X23
97: #endif
